Tower rolled back for late-night Delta 2 launch
Posted: March 14, 2008
The United Launch Alliance Delta 2 rocket stands ready for liftoff from Cape Canaveral's pad 17A following rollback of the mobile service tower. The rocket will launch into orbit the GPS 2R-19 navigation satellite for the Global Positioning System.
